What is the proper usecases of API system ?

The number of online based companies and companies providing services through websites is currently innumerable. Big companies like Google, Facebook, Twitter have arranged for their services to be displayed on third party sites to keep them at bay.If you have visited many websites, you must notice that the articles are on that site but there are direct Facebook comments added, that is, Facebook comments can be made on the articles of the website and the comments are also published on Facebook. Again, you can see the latest posts on Twitter from the website, all of which are made possible by the API.

 

You can see in Twitter that you can login using Facebook or Google account, how does it work? Kora is directly connected to Facebook, Google's user database, when a user logs in through Facebook, Facebook provides Kora with the details of that user and logs in to Kora.

In this, all the work is done with one account of yours. The main purpose of API is to improve the quality of service by bringing all websites and software together.

API usecase  in Government system : 

In addition to software or websites or browsers, the government itself uses APIs to control various services from one place. Databases of different forces of the country may be tied to the same source where all the information can be found by searching for information from one need to another. CCTV cameras of all the cities are also connected to control from one place.The biggest advantage of API is that there is no need to re-program to add new features to any application. Rather the benefits can be added from one application to another. Suppose an application can only have text chat but it is possible to get all the features including voice chat, video chat by connecting it with the API of another application. You can create your own Facebook app or messenger using Facebook API even if you want.


At  the toturial conclusion : 

So what we mean by API is basically a tool where one application can connect to another application through programming and command usage and share their own features with each other. Computer software, applications, websites, web applications, servers, databases, etc. can be connected through APIA. This connection further enhances the service and helps to control everything and provide all the features from one place.
